pigloaf 236 Posted April 29, 2019 (edited) Unfortunately we currently can't use community liveries for DLC cars. We can't unpack the .nefs, and it also appears the folder method doesn't work for DLC cars either, using DiRT 4 models (until we get confirmation otherwise). This rules out the whole 2000cc class 😢 We can replace the whole .nefs with a D4 model but that breaks the game. Hoping we get some support from CM here.
